Experience the charm of Porto Moniz, Portugal in October, where the maximum temperature reaches a pleasant 25°C (77°F), while the average hovers around 20°C (69°F). With a comfortable minimum of 17°C (62°F), the weather is perfect for outdoor exploration. Expect about 42 mm (1.7 in) of rainfall over 6 days, contributing to the lush landscapes that this beautiful coastal town is known for. High humidity levels at 80% add to the inviting atmosphere, making it an ideal time to enjoy the natural pools and stunning scenery that Porto Moniz has to offer.

October in Porto Moniz marks the transition into the wetter months of the year, with precipitation levels reaching 42 mm (1.7 inches) over approximately 6 days. This increase is a notable rise from the drier summer months, where July and August barely recorded any rainfall at just 3 mm each. As autumn deepens, the region begins to prepare for November's significantly higher total of 72 mm (2.8 inches), illustrating a clear trend of escalating precipitation as the year progresses. In October, Porto Moniz experiences a gentle shift in its breezy temperament, with an average wind speed of 4.0 m/s (9 mph), marking the lowest for the year. This decrease follows a summer peak, where winds reach up to 5.4 m/s (12 mph) in July and rarely dip below 4.4 m/s (10 mph) in the months prior. As autumn settles in, the winds soften, creating a more tranquil atmosphere. However, this calmness is short-lived, as November once again sees winds pick up to 4.5 m/s (10 mph), emphasizing Porto Moniz’s dynamic climate.
